Functional Description ? help Back to Top
Source Description
UniProtTranscription factor involved in the negative regulation of flowering. May be involved in the repression of the flowering factor GI and HD1 by interacting with PIL13 and PIL15 and competing with PRR1. Possesses transactivation activity in yeast. {ECO:0000269|PubMed:21549224}.
